    It took about 10 days for them to find what I wanted but I finally picked it up today. 2021 SR5 in magnetic gray metallic. The only option I wanted was the spray-in bed liner but I also ended up with the step boards and the black-out logos. There is also a rail tie-down system in the bed but the salesman said it was standard? I was also very pleasantly surprised at the under-seat storage compartments un the rear seats, as I thought that was also an option.

    The most modern vehicle I have ever owned was mu 2003 Tundra and it had 40K miles on it when I bought it, so I have a LOT of catching up to do in the technology department. The radar cruise-control and lane departure warning were "interesting" on the way home but man did I ever love synching my iPhone with the screen for navigating.

    The drive home was an hour and a half of mostly freeway so that's it for today.
